Karaca, Cahit Yilmaz, Rasim Farajov, Zaza Iakobadze, Kamil Kilic, Sema Aydogdu – 11 July 2020 – Biliary complications (BCs) are still a major cause of morbidity following liver transplantation despite the advancements in the surgical technique. Although Roux‐en‐Y (RY) hepaticojejunostomy has been the standard technique for years in pediatric patients, there is a limited number of reports on the feasibility of duct‐to‐duct (DD) anastomosis, and those reports have controversial outcomes.

Rader – 8 July 2020 – Establishment of a physiologically relevant human hepatocyte‐like cell system for in vitro translational research has been hampered by the limited availability of cell models that accurately reflect human biology and the pathophysiology of human disease. Here we report a robust, reproducible, and scalable protocol for the generation of hepatic organoids from human induced pluripotent stem cells (hiPSCs) using short exposure to nonengineered matrices.
